intrafallopian /in·tra·fal·lo·pi·an/ (-fah-lo´pe-an) within the uterine(fallopian) tube.
in·tra·fal·lo·pi·an (ntr-f-lp-n)
adj.
Located or occurring within the fallopian tubes.
